correct me if I am wrong, but if you had already purchased FTTF, there is no need to check in at airport...You should go directly to ship...as you will be ahead of the airport express passengers...correct??

 

FTTF will allow you to bypass the general boarding passengers at the port terminal whenever you get there. You will be afforded early boarding. Not sure what you are referring to at the airport. FTTF has nothing to do with that or the airport express.

I believe the op is referring to Miami airport, where you can check in for your Carnival cruise. And I believe you bypass the regular lines/times and go straight in. When we checkin for Glory in august when we were in line for the initial document check (we are platinum) I could see people ahead who already had sail & sign cards. The rest of us went through security and checked in upstairs. EM
